The place of Chapultepec is inside the municipality of El Mante (in the State of Tamaulipas). There are 5 inhabitants. In the list of the most populated towns of the whole municipality, it is the number #124 of the ranking. Chapultepec is at 83 meters of altitude.
The Mexican authorities declared this village as uninhabited in 2020.
Do you want to locate the town of Chapultepec? You can find it at 4.5 kilometers, in direction West, from the town of Ciudad Mante, which has the largest population within the municipality. #6 The Postal Code of Chapultepec (Tamaulipas) is 89846
Are you going to send a letter to Chapultepec? Do you have a friend in Chapultepec and want to send them a gift through the postal service? The Postal Code of Chapultepec consists of the following 5 digits: 89846. If you want to know more about how Post Codes are determined in Mexico, the first two postal digits of Chapultepec ("89") correspond to the state code of Tamaulipas, and the last three correspond to the people themselves. In Mexico, the same ZIP code can be assigned to several towns.
